    IE will not send user id in http headers. You can get the user id if you do NTLM authentication which the web server does not support. If your app is java based you can look into doing NTLM auth in Java and get the user id that way.

    I doubt the problem has to do with the Content-Length
    header.
    I'd guess that you're using SSL. Are you? If so,
    you're almost certainly bumping into a known bug (or,
    as Microsoft describes it, a "feature") in Internet
    Explorer. Microsoft article KB316431 at
    http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=316431h
    as some information on the problem. As the article
    points out, the problem occurs when Internet Explorer
    needs to invoke an external application to handle a
    file that was served over SSL with Cache-Control:
    no-cache and/or Pragma: no-cache headers.
    A work around would be force Web Server to send
    Cache-Control and Pragma headers that don't include
    the no-cache directive. For example, the following
    lines could be added to the obj.conf configuration
    file:<Object ppath="*.jnlp">
    Output fn="set-variable" set-srvhdrs="Cache-Control:
    private"
    Output fn="set-variable" set-srvhdrs="Pragma:
    private"
    </Object>Fortunately, it sounds like you've already
    found another viable work around.

    Your stack trace indicates classes that are not part of Sun ONE Web Server 6.1 (e.g. com.iplanet.server.http.servlet.NSServletEntity) but are classes in earlier releases of the web server. It looks like your web application contains classes or .jar files that contain an older implementation of the JSP engine from a previous web server release. Remove these and give it another try.
